Downsview Park presents a singular mixture of expansive house and accessibility, a uncommon discover throughout the city sprawl. Its historical past, as a former navy airbase, left behind huge open areas able to accommodating massive crowds and sophisticated staging. Whereas different venues exist, few can rival Downsview’s capability to host occasions of this scale with out inflicting undue disruption to residential areas. The park’s relative isolation from dense housing, coupled with its proximity to main transportation arteries, makes it a sensible, albeit not universally cherished, selection.

Sound ranges are rigorously monitored at varied factors within the surrounding neighborhood, and changes are made in real-time to reduce sound bleed. Bass frequencies, recognized for his or her capability to journey lengthy distances, are significantly scrutinized. Whereas full silence is unattainable, organizers try to strike a steadiness between delivering a robust audio expertise for attendees and respecting the peace of close by neighborhoods.

Tip 1: Embrace Public Transportation or Plan Parking Meticulously: Downsview Park’s location, whereas accessible, turns into a bottleneck throughout these occasions. Site visitors snarls and parking turn into strategic battles. Arrive early to safe a parking spot, or, ideally, make the most of public transportation. The subway station affords direct entry, however even this turns into crowded. Weigh the choices, consider potential delays, and select accordingly. Expertise dictates a proactive strategy to keep away from pre-concert frustration.

Tip 2: Hydration is Not Non-obligatory: The sheer scale of those occasions, mixed with the usually relentless summer time warmth, creates an ideal storm for dehydration. Water stations can be found, however strains could be lengthy. Deliver a reusable water bottle and refill it ceaselessly. Dehydration impairs judgment, reduces vitality, and may result in severe medical problems. Prioritize hydration as a crucial element of the expertise.

Tip 3: Familiarize Your self with the Structure Beforehand: Downsview Park is huge, and navigating the live performance grounds and not using a plan is a recipe for disorientation. Examine the occasion map, establish key places resembling water stations, restrooms, and first-aid tents. Designate a gathering level with companions in case of separation. Realizing the lay of the land isn’t a luxurious; it is a necessity for environment friendly navigation and peace of thoughts.

Tip 4: Safe Your Belongings: Massive crowds appeal to opportunistic people. Be vigilant about private belongings. Hold valuables shut and think about using a cross-body bag or a fanny pack. Keep away from displaying costly jewellery or electronics unnecessarily. Consciousness is the primary line of protection in opposition to theft. A small funding in safety can stop a big loss.

Tip 5: Defend Your Listening to: The amplified music at these occasions can attain damaging decibel ranges. Extended publicity to loud noise can result in irreversible listening to loss. Think about using earplugs to guard your ears. These small units can considerably cut back the danger of long-term auditory harm with out sacrificing the live performance expertise. Listening to safety is an funding in your future well-being.

Tip 6: Put together for All Climate Situations: Summer time climate in Toronto could be unpredictable. Sunshine can rapidly give technique to thunderstorms. Examine the forecast beforehand and costume accordingly. Deliver sunscreen, a hat, and a poncho or rain jacket. Layering clothes permits for adaptation to altering temperatures. Preparedness ensures consolation and prevents weather-related discomfort or sickness.
